Ingredients for 2 servings:

  • 1 m.-large white cabbage
  • Garlic, 1 piece of a fresh clove
  • ¼ tsp sugar
  • ½ tsp salt
  • 100 ml cream (organic cream)
  • some safflower oil
  • Water

Instructions

Working time approx. 10 minutes; Cooking/baking time approx. 45 minutes; Total time approx. 55 minutes

for histamine and salicylate intolerance

Remove the outer leaves from the cabbage, halve the cabbage, remove the stalk, chop the cabbage, place it in a colander, rinse well, and let it drain briefly. Heat oil in a pan, sauté the cabbage, stirring frequently. When it begins to brown slightly, add the sugar and garlic and fry briefly. Add approximately 500 ml of water and the salt. Simmer for 20 minutes. Remove the lid and simmer for 10 minutes. Add the cream and simmer for 10 minutes, until the liquid is well reduced and the vegetables are creamy. Season with salt if desired. This goes well with homemade mashed potatoes and roasted meat. Makes 2 servings as a side dish or 1 serving as a main course. I use organic cream, as “regular” cream usually contains carrageenan (E407), a strong histamine liberator. Since not every oil is tolerated in cases of histamine intolerance, I use safflower oil, or at best rapeseed oil.
